资源简介
本人为了获得更多资源共享的权限,只好吐血奉献自己一年来收集和改写的matlab源程序,部分为原创;里面包含有主成分分析、岭回归分析、因子分析、判别分析、聚类分析、回归分析等;绝对可用哦,不过,还是得提醒一下,由于一直是自己使用,里面没有更多注释,希望没有这方面知识基础的朋友慎重下载哪,免得浪费精力撒。
主成分分析,基于matlab的程序源代码,拿来既可以用的
代码片段和文件信息
%清空环境变量
clear all
clc
% %读产量数据
% grain_data = xlsread(‘C:\Users\Adminitrator\Desktop\dataset\grain0017\grain0017‘);
% %选出自变量
% xgrain_data = grain_data(:[2:12])
% %数据标准化
% [xx_meanx_std]=zscore(xgrain_data)
%读温度数据
tem_data = xlsread(‘C:\Users\Adminitrator\Desktop\dataset\temp_datapca\data‘);
%选出自变量
xtem_data = tem_data(:[2:5])
%数据标准化
[xx_meanx_std]=zscore(xtem_data)
%利用princomp处理矩阵
[coefscoreeigt]=pca(x);
%每一组数据在新坐标下到原点的距
t
s=0;
i=1;
%获得累计贡献率大于85%几组数据
while s/sum(eig)<0.95
s=s+eig(i);
i=i+1;
end
%输出新的数据
NEW=x*coef(:1:i-1)
W=100*eig/sum(eig)
%输出贡献率直方图
figure(1)
pareto(eig/sum(eig));
figure(2)
plot(eig‘r+‘);
hold on
plot(eig‘b-‘);
tle
- 上一篇:小波模极大值算法边缘检测
- 下一篇:系统辨识与自适应控制MATLAB仿真 全部程序
相关资源
- HMMforspeechrecogntion 一个可执行的HMM语音
- popular-UCI-datasets 一些非常有用的数据
- GAPSO 这个算法是遗传算法和粒子群优
- synchronization 利用matlab仿真实现载波的
- Gabor Gabor小波变换的matlab实现
- 4 matlab区域填充的具体算法及演示
- MATLAB_image_process_with_PDE 运用偏微分方
- gabijiao 该程序通过实例(函数)
- SIFT2844912
- gbvs 二维图像视觉显著性检测
- wenli 分析了纹理特征提取方法
- EELM
- barcode 基于图像的条形码识别程序(识
-
myaudiopla
yer 使用Matlab GUI实现的音频 - B-spline-surface 在MATLAB-2008a环境下编写的
- NURBS-surface 在MATLAB-2008a环境下编写的
- ACO 用MATLAB编写的蚁群算法最短路径寻
- wavplay 基于matlab GUI界面的播放器
- allfns 是由牛津大学VGG开发的三维重建
- spectrogram_fft
- adaboost 基于adaboost的人脸识别程序
- 2 2课程报告要求:按照讲课内容
- gps GPS信号的捕获、处理程序
- fuzzynetme 模糊神经网络的MATLAB程序
- naive_bayes_numeric 利用matlab实现的朴素贝
- MFandMPF 计算肌电信号积分肌电值
- BM3D BM3D去噪算法的实现和相关文档
- BarrelDistortion 两个matlab程序
- Kalman 用卡尔曼滤波跟踪目标实例
- WSN-matlab-simulation
评论
共有 条评论